Keeping Your Family Safe At Home With A Few Common Sense Tips

What is the best home security option for your home and family?  When you are assessing the current home security plan any and all corrective action you do to protect your home and family is a step closer to more secure home.

 

Some home security tips to begin thinking about are items that will detour or basically stop a potential intruder from coming into your residence.  A home alarm system is always a terrific option to take into consideration with the rest of these tips.

 

The first thing you will want to do is examine your home from the outside.  Make sure your home is well lit.  Motion sensors are one way to go however a home with lightening that is substantial and always on.  Another thing to look for his potential hiding spots close to all the doors and windows.  If you spot an issue on the outside of your home than be for sure a burglar will take advantage of that.  A seasoned burglar looks for ways in to your home. Your job is to make sure that they are all well lit.  Why?  A well lit yard is a burglar’s worst enemy, darkness is its friend.

 

It is important that you think of ways that you can slow a potential intruder’s entrance into your home.  Simple home security measures help along with the use of home alarm systems.  The addition of deadbolts on the homes doors is an important step to take.  Another element is to add a solid bracket inside of all door walls.  These elements help to deter potential intruders and at the very least will slow them down.  The more time it takes for them to enter the home the more discouraged they will become and since time is of the essence this is important.

Another element like light that acts is a deterrent is noise.  Choosing a home security alarm that is activated by doors and windows opening or by any motion is effective.  The alarms that are the most efficient at turning intruders away are loud noises such as a barking dog whether real or a recording is most effective.

 

The three most successful tips and biggest enemies to burglars are light, noise and time.  If you put these home security tips into place you are helping to prevent any possible break-ins.  Here are a few other ways you can help yourself.

 

  • Don’t display valuables in view of people on the outside.  It is temptation to some people.  Consider putting items of great value that are on the smaller side in a safe.  Many safes can be made to look like common everyday items, these are called diversion safes.
  • Implore the people in your community to begin a neighborhood watch.  Anyone who is a stranger will stick out like a sore thumb.  With a neighborhood watch in place the police will be notified when someone suspicious is in the area.
  • Anytime you leave your home on an overnight trip or extended vacation make your home look occupied.  Use lights on varied timers so that they all go off at different times each and every night.  Televisions and radios can also be set on timers to make it appears as if you are home even when you are not.
  • Lock all doors and windows even when gone for brief periods of time.  This is especially important during the summer.  A huge temptation for thieves is open windows and garages.

 

A few simple changes can make a world of difference in making your home less intrusive.  Begin with an assessment of your home.  Create a well lit, secure home that detours intruders from making your belongings theirs.

Where should a homeowner begin when deciding upon window treatments?  The first thing to determine is if a hard or soft window treatment option is desired.  Maybe even a combination of the two is what will work for the function and style desired within the space.

  • Hard Window Treatments:  This includes any treatment that contains a hard material such as wood or vinyl.  Some examples include window shades and blinds as well as shutters.
  • Soft Window Treatments: This includes any treatment that contains soft materials such as sheers, curtains, drapery, swags and valances.  Roman shades are often included in this category.
  • Combination of Hard and Soft Window Treatments:  This is a combination of the two on one window.  This can be a very hard look to install and should be done so using careful precise measurements.  Valances and window blinds are often used in combination as well as sheer curtains and vinyl room darkening shades where light is an issue such as a bedroom.

Many insurance companies offer supplemental insurance plans for Medicare.  The one thing to remember is that with all Medicare and Medigap policies the coverage will be the exact same no matter where it is purchased.  The prices will vary due to the company sponsoring the plan.  When you purchase Medicare supplemental insurance plan g or Medicare supple insurance plan n the coverage at one company will be the exact same as another.  The difference will be the cost of the policy and this can be varied do to the level of service offered.

The great thing about many online companies is that they offer clients to compare Medicare supplemental insurance rates and plans offered by multiple insurance companies without offering up any personal information.  These same sites often offer the chance to buy Medigap supplemental insurance through them acting as a facilitator in getting you the best supplemental insurance rate and coverage to fit your exact need.  They offer online support as well as assistance free help over the phone.  Advisors that are up to date on all topics related to Medicare will assist you in obtaining the right coverage for your need at a desirable price.

Medigap Plan G, Plan F and Plan N are currently the most popular option amongst Medicare recipients.  When considering a plan that will work for your situation it is important to look at everything that is covered by the plan and as well as what is not covered. We will take a look into just one of the many Medicare supplemental plans, plan N.

Medigap supplemental insurance plan N offers one feature that many people find incredibly important in their Medicare Health Coverage; it covers the twenty percent of the doctor and hospital bills left over from traditional Medicare coverage.  The twenty percent that is covered has no limit and is often astronomical when talking about major illness or injury.  Take for instance a one hundred thousand dollar procedure.  Medicare traditionally covers eighty thousand and the recipient is left to cover the other twenty percent on his or her own. Medigap supplemental insurance plan N would be one of the many Medigap plans that cover this extra expense.  In addition plan N covers the part A yearly deductible.

However plan N does not cover the Medicare plan B deductible.  It also uses a method known as cost-sharing when handling doctor’s office visits.  This would that you either pay twenty percent or twenty dollars whichever is less when going in for an office visit.  With this plan there is also an additional out of pocket co-pay due for emergency room visits.
